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61984971 7775727 532 5401783198 18703692158
29 446316
29 446316
4520739 20745323 03
All about undefined
Interested in learning more?
29 446316
4520739 20745323 03
See more
12 7722 46
887 232657073 5307835 5776 94
See more
629 52240002399
0273 94402036531 002 1703 45810140
See more